Platinum-induced neurotoxicity: A review of possible mechanisms

Patients treated with platinum-based chemotherapy frequently experience neurotoxic symptoms, which may lead to premature discontinuation of therapy. Despite discontinuation of platinum drugs, these symptoms can persist over a long period of time. Cisplatin and oxaliplatin, among all platinum drugs, have significant neurotoxic potential. Mechanisms of vincristine-induced neurotoxicity: Possible reversal by erythropoietin.

Vincristine (VCR) is a potent anticancer drug, but neurotoxicity is one of its most important dose-limiting toxicities. In this study, we investigated the neurotoxic effect of VCR, the possible mechanisms and the role of erythropoietin (EPO) in the protection against VCR-induced neurotoxicity in a rat model. Mechanisms of methylmercury-induced neurotoxicity.

Mercury in both organic and inorganic forms is neurotoxic. Methylmercury (MeHg) is a commonly encountered form of mercury in the environment. Early electrophysiological experiments revealed that MeHg potently affects the release of neurotransmitter from presynaptic nerve terminals. Current View in Platinum Drug Mechanisms of Peripheral Neurotoxicity

Peripheral neurotoxicity is the dose-limiting factor for clinical use of platinum derivatives, a class of anticancer drugs which includes cisplatin, carboplatin, and oxaliplatin. In particular cisplatin and oxaliplatin induce a severe peripheral neurotoxicity while carboplatin is less neurotoxic. Fluoroquinolone Induced Neurotoxicity: A Review

Introduction: Fluoroquinolones (FQs) are commonly used antibiotics both in inpatient and outpatient settings. Their therapeutic use ranges from the common respiratory, urinary tract and gastrointestinal infections to management of drug resistant tuberculosis and febrile neutropenia in immunocompromised patients.
